Cyprus Gains Diplomatic Momentum After High-Level Meeting With US Secretary of State

The USA and Cyprus appear to be entering a new phase of strategic cooperation following a high-level meeting in Washington on Monday between US Secretary of State Marco Rubio and Cypriot Foreign Minister Constantinos Kombos, with Cyprus being thanked for its support in promoting regional security and humanitarian aid to Gaza.

The meeting focused on energy security, defense cooperation and the advancement of trans-Atlantic cooperation in general, humanitarian coordination, and preparations ahead of Cyprus’ assuming the Presidency of the Council of the European Union in 2026.

According to the official read-out from the US State Department, both sides welcomed the “strong and deepening ties” between Washington and Nicosia and emphasized a shared interest in maintaining stability in the Eastern Mediterranean. This engagement comes at a crucial moment for Europe, as it progresses efforts to ensure energy independence and regional security amid global geopolitical shifts. Cyprus is expected to play a central role when it takes over the EU Presidency.

Energy and security take center stage in USA-Cyprus meeting

Energy cooperation was a central theme of the discussion, with both governments highlighting shared interest in developing infrastructure tied to natural gas, renewables, and connectivity projects in the Eastern Mediterranean. This follows growing trilateral cooperation between Israel, Cyprus, and Greece.

Rubio also underscored the strategic role Cyprus plays in maritime domain awareness and crisis response. The United States has increasingly signaled interest in defense cooperation frameworks with Nicosia.

Humanitarian and migration coordination in Gaza

The meeting also acknowledged Cyprus’ growing humanitarian role in the Middle East, including its involvement in Gaza aid logistics and regional evacuation capabilities. Rubio thanked Cyprus for its contributions and assistance in helping coordinate migration response systems under EU and UN frameworks.

Future cooperation: USA – Cyprus strategic dialogue

One of the most consequential outcomes of the meeting was agreement to explore the establishment of a formal US–Cyprus strategic dialogue—a structured diplomatic framework typically reserved for key US partners. If finalized, such a mechanism would institutionalize cooperation across sectors including defense, energy, cybersecurity, and humanitarian operations.

International experts note that the tone of the discussion and the timing ahead of Cyprus’ EU leadership role suggest Washington views Cyprus as a rising diplomatic and geopolitical stakeholder in the Mediterranean.
